Cristiano Ronaldo is unsurprisingly among three Manchester United stars that Rasmus Hojlund has revealed he grew up idolising.

Aged 21 and a huge United fan, the striker grew up watching the club dominate English football by winning a catalogue of major honours.

Success was delivered by some of the biggest and best players in the business and United's past talent will have been a huge source of inspiration for today's prospects.

Hojlund is certainly no exception, with the youngster citing five-time Ballon d'Or winner and global superstar Ronaldo as his idol.

When asked on The United Stand to name his most influential players Hojlund responded: "It has to be Cristiano.

"[Wayne] Rooney as well I'm thinking about, [Carlos] Tevez as well, but Cristiano was probably the guy.

"I remember supporting him and following him the next year as well, and following him back again and watching him in the period when he was at Juventus and Real Madrid as well.

"He has always been my idol and I've followed the clubs where he's been and supporting United, they were my first team really."

Ronaldo joined United at the age of 18 and became one of the best players in world football during a glittering first spell at Old Trafford.

The Portuguese legend, who is adored by millions, won three Premier League titles and the Champions League at the club.

Playing alongside him in the formidable attack was Rooney, United's all-time top scorer who netted 253 goals for them during a 13-year spell.

He was also named in the Premier League Hall of Fame, cementing his status as a legend in English football folklore.

Tevez spent just two years at United on loan from West Ham but his time at Old Trafford was certainly not shy of success.

The Argentinian won five major honours and scored 34 goals for the club, although controversially signed for rivals Manchester City after he left.

Hojlund can certainly take inspiration from all three names as he continues to find his feet at United following a difficult start after his £72million move from Atalanta.

He has scored four goals in his last four appearances for the club and has a tally of ten in total for the season so far.
